Online document sharing platform is the product of the information age,and it is also the user’s desire for others the result of lessons learned.The paper introduce the relevant technical of this system of document sharing platform,analyze how to use existing technology to build large systems which can support a largenumber of users access, and how to use them flexibly. The article starts with the architectureof document sharing platform which uses the hierarchical model. Communication betweenlayers is using the interface,which can reduce coupling of system, in order to improve systemrobustness. If System wants to support a large number of users to access, should be used indistributed architecture. Reasonably divide large system into subsystem is help to makedevelopment process easily. Therefore the part of the detailed design show us the documentsharing platform will be further divided into document management subsystem, conversionsubsystem and retrieval subsystem. The subsystems working in parallel. Documentmanagement subsystem and conversion subsystem communicate by PHPRPC protocol. Thisdesign can improve system scalability.In this paper, it provides a solution which from system architecture to the technicaldetails of achieving a document sharing platform. |
